Xiao Li

Fashion Designer

Chinese designer Xiao Li studied fashion at Royal College of Art followed by London College of Fashion. A knitwear specialist, she has worked with acclaimed designers including J.W. Anderson, Alexander McQueen and Anya Hindmarch. In 2013 she won the prestigious International Talent Support Award, which included a stint working at the Diesel headquarters. Her work was also showcased at various fashion weeks including Hungary and London. She was selected as a finalist for the LVMH Fashion Prize 2015.
